Why is my 62' C10 Dying after 5 minutes of Driving?

1962 Chevy C10. [350 small block with msd drop in vacuum advance
distributor and a Carter  600-No Choke. 3 on the tree with overdrive.] New
keyed Ignition cylinder, new upgraded fuse box, clean set up. Runs Great.
Fires right up. But after 5-10 minutes of driving it bogs and then dies. I pull
over and after a little pumping, right as i release the pedal it fires back up.
Drives for 1-2 minutes and does it all over again. until it gets very hard to
start back up.

Do you have a fuel line ran too close to something hot? Might be vapor lock. Running a mechanical fuel pump or electric?
